THE NAP (BEST BET) RUNS OVER AT CHEPSTOW ON BANK HOLIDAY MONDAY!
Chepstow 4.35 Persian Royal (11/8)
Al Kazeem colt who looked as though he’d improve plenty for the experience when a close second to Last Hoorah on debut; 4lb better off now and should be a lot sharper; obvious chance to reverse the form.
With Pavlodar a non runner this looks a great opportunity for PERSIAN ROYAL to strike. He showed plenty of ability on debut to finish a close second to Last Hoorah and with improvement a near certainty and off 4lb better terms he is going to prove hard to beat here. He is obviously bred to be pretty useful and this represents a good chance to open his account. Ha’penny just hasn’t shown enough to be a factor here but obviously he will step forward at some point. Sheer Rocks is the most interesting of the newcomers but there hasn’t really been much market support for him and I think he is likely to benefit from the outing. Burtonlodge Angel and Bearing Bob are both best watched.

THE NEXT BEST (SECOND BEST BET) RUNS OVER AT EPSOM ON BANK HOLIDAY MONDAY!
Epsom 3.45 Cemhaan (13/8)
Ran a cracker over C&D last month going down just half a length at the line; jockey takes a handy 2lb off so technically gets to run off the same mark here; standout on the clock; appeals as the most likely winner in this field.
Not the deepest of renewals and I really like the chances of CEMHAAN. He ran over course and distance in July finishing second off a mark of 77. He technically gets to run off the same mark today as Matthew Ennis takes 2lb off. That was the best time figure over this trip and if he is in the same form he is the one to beat. The opposition isn’t that strong but Great Esteem would rate the main danger back down to a mark of 86 and he could be well handicapped considering his last win came off a mark of 88. Maori Knight often attracts support but has become a bit frustrating. He goes up in trip now and I’m not sure he is screaming out for a mile and a half. I think it’s likely to go against him if anything.
